The NCFD Farm Club baseball complex and the Bowie Baseball Academy are striving to provide affordable andprofessional style baseball venues for youth and adult baseball players throughout the Central Texas community.

The creation of the NCFD Farm Club is to provide theAustin, San Antonio area communities with access tobaseball practice and game fields at a professional levelthat does not exist in this region. The NCFD Farm Clubcurrently has five pro-style practice infields with battingcages, six 12U age stadium baseball fields and a 6,000sq ft indoor training facility operated by former majorleague baseball player Micah Bowie.

The facility is built on farm land in the Zorn arealocated just outside the city limits of San Marcos, Texas.Our location is centrally located just off Hwy 123 andonly ten minutes from IH 10 in Seguin and IH 35 in SanMarcos.

The design of the NCFD Farm Club complex is basedon years of research and experience by NCFDʼs

president, Earl Studdard. Earl has interviewed designersof baseball complexes and grounds keepers throughoutthe country including Nolan Ryanʼs minor league RoundRock Express. Texas State University also played a bigpart in helping to shape the design of the complex. Earlʼscoaching experience and his coordination of the construc-tion of five baseball fields for the New Braunfels LittleLeague helped develop the knowledge of what it takes tobuild a player, coach and fan friendly baseball complex.The complex will enable a coach to use a practice infieldand batting cage to warm up their team before a game.The dugouts and stands will have water mist cooling fansto help everyone battle the Texas summer heat. Safetyfor the players and fans has been designed into everyarea of the complex to provide a great safe visit to thecomplex for all.

Teams currently playing in select baseball tournamentshave to travel to Houston or Dallas to play in tournamentsheld on fields comparable to our complex. Parents ofplayers on local teams arevery excited about havinga baseball complex of thismagnitude in our commu-nity. The San Marcos areaoffers many tourist interestsbut also that small towndraw that will lure teamsfrom outside our communityto come and play in ourtournaments throughout theyear.

ay Kinsella would be proud. The Iowa corn farmer,played by Kevin Costner in the movie “Field of Dreams,”

heard voices urging him to build a baseball diamond in hiscorn field.

If Kinsella heard whispers, Earl Studdard, president ofNorth Carolina Furniture Direct and founder of the newNorth Carolina Furniture Direct Farm Club, must have heardshouts.

On 88 acres along Old Zorn Road near San Marcos,Studdard is building a baseball complex that eventually willinclude 19 professional-grade stadium fields.

“This is a dream come true,” said Studdard, who playedhigh school baseball and whose son, Drew, plays baseball asa freshman at Texas Lutheran University. “The rewards willbe huge for the youth that will make lifelong memorieshere on the baseball fields.

“Baseball is a family game. It is a team sport. You win andlose as a team. You have fun as a team.”

Studdard wants that fun to extend beyond the players. Hewants the coaches and umpires to have fun, too. Knowingmost of the professional-grade baseball complexes foryouth were located in the Dallas and Houston areas, Stud-dard relied on his retail background to come up with a plan,and what a plan it was.

In 2008, he bought the 88 acres of cow pastures. TheKevin Costner baseball movie reference is not lost on him.“We talked about planting some corn just to have corn bythe stadium fields,” he said.

Youth baseball continues to grow despite the currenteconomic conditions. Currently over 2.6 million childrenplay organized baseball or softball nationwide, accord-ing to Little League Baseball.Youth baseball tournaments hosted by select teams

in our area now have to split their games between areahigh schools and limited city fields. This creates difficultlogistic issues for players, coaches,game officials and families. Thelargest Little League complex in ourarea is the New Braunfels LittleLeague, which does not allow selectbaseball to play at their facility.Our baseball complex will be the

largest baseball only complex in theGulf Coast region with room for ex-

pansion as demand requires it. Complex 1 was com-pleted in 2010 and has 5 pro-style practice infields withbatting cages, 8 prostyle bullpens, information centerand a 6,000 square foot indoor training facility.Complex 3 which was completed in 2012 has six 12U

stadium fields with 500 + seating at each field and a6,300 sq ft concession and office building. Complex 4

will be our next to build which will featuretwo 18U/ 13U stadium fields and four 12Ustadium fields. This should be completedby the middle of 2013. Complex 2 will fea-ture two 18U/ College stadium fields with2000 + seat capacity, two 18U/ 13U stadiumfields and three 12U stadium fields. Com-plex 2 should be completed by the end of2014.

Studdard wants that fun to extend beyond the players. He wants thecoaches and umpires to have fun, too. Knowing most of the professional-grade baseball complexes for youth were located in the Dallas and Houstonareas, Studdard relied on his retail background to come up with a plan, andwhat a plan it was. In 2008, he bought the 88 acres of cow pastures. TheKevin Costner baseball movie reference is not lost on him. “We talked aboutplanting some corn just to have corn by the stadium fields,” he said.

The first thing Studdard did is build Complex 1 — the portion that in-cludes five practice infields, each with a covered batting cage. There also areeight bullpens, which like the infields, are designed to accommodate playersfrom the very young to adults.

It all blended into the NCFD Farm Club’s overall mission — to provide af-fordable, professionalstyle baseball venues for baseball players throughoutthe Central Texas community.

The practice infields were designed to mirror major league practice fields,allowing players and coaches to get the maximum benefits of practice time.“This is where the scouts will stand to watch,” Studdard said, pointing to aspot behind the bullpen fence.

Complex 1 also is the sight of the 6,000 squarefoot Bowie Baseball Acad-emy. The training building is owned and operated by former major leaguebaseball player Micah Bowie. The academy offers private instruction as wellas special events, such as last summer’s Legends for Youth Clinic that fea-tured former major league players.

Five youth select teams from New Braunfels already practice at the FarmClub, which has hosted practice for Texas Lutheran players and in the nearfuture will also host practices for Texas State University club baseballers.

Complex 2 will include four high school-college level stadium (profession-

algrade) fields. Complex 3 will include nine 12U (12- and-under division)fields. Complex 4 will include two high school fields and four 12U fields.

“When it is finished, it will include 19 stadium fields,” Studdard said.The projected completion date for the entire complex is 2014. Studdard

expects construction on Complex 3 to be completed by late April.Offering stadium-style seating, professional dugouts, a 6,300 squarefoot

concession building and a bullpen at every field, Complex 3 offers the com-plete baseball experience.

“This field will be our replica of Fenway Field,” Studdard said, pointing to afield on the other side of the concession stand he hopes mirrors the home ofthe Boston Red Sox. “We will have a replica of the Green Monster that willbe 16 feet high. This will be our home run park. York Creek is right on theother side. If they hit a home run, they will hit it into York Creek.”

The design of the complex pays attention to every aspect of the game.Part of the concession building will include a locker room for umpires.Grandparents will be able to enjoy limousine golf cart rides to and from thestadium fields.

“We got that idea in Phoenix, because the fields are so far away from theparking lot there,” Studdard said.

That won’t be the case at the Farm Club. But just the same, Studdardwants to make sure everyone who comes out to the complex enjoys the day... a day at the old ball game.
